Electricity employees strike in UP in protest against privatization, Mahoba DM terminates service of 5 contract workers
Vishal Verma, Mahoba: The contract workers of the Electricity Department have gone on strike in every district of Uttar Pradesh to protest against privatization, regarding which the State Government and the Energy Minister, adopting a strict attitude, have also instructed the DMs of the districts to take strict action. Its effect was seen in Mahoba district. DM Manoj Kumar has given instructions to terminate the services of 5 electrical contract workers and register an FIR.

The electricity contract workers in the state had announced a 72-hour work boycott regarding their 14-point demands and went on strike from Thursday. Because of this, the power system broke down in many districts and at some places the common people blocked the roads. Taking this matter seriously, the government asked the District Magistrates of the state to adopt a strict attitude and if they did not agree, they would end their service. On the orders of the government, the Mahoba DM has directed to terminate the services of 5 electrical contract workers and register an FIR and instructions have also been given to replace them with new personnel.

Allegations of anti-promise on the government

In the entire state, the employees of the Electricity Department are staging a work boycott strike regarding their 14-point demands. The effect of which is also visible on the power supply. In Mahoba’s Kirat Sagar power sub-station, all the electrical workers are shouting slogans against the government’s promise with placards in their hands. In such a situation, DM’s strict action has also come to the fore regarding the faulty electrical system. Describing the strike of electrical workers as illegal, DM Manoj Kumar terminated the service of 5 contract workers. Even after being an outsourced worker, he was involved in the strike, for which the DM has shown strictness.

Outsourced company blacklisted

DM Manoj Kumar has terminated the services of Arthav, Dilshad, Kalicharan, Rajbahadur and Salim working on contract. The DM clearly said that if there is any impact on the power system, no one will be spared. At the same time, the DM has given instructions to blacklist the outsourced company as well. During this, the DM also checked the power supply arrangements by reaching the power sub-station, for which technical officers of revenue and other departments have been deployed in the presence of duty magistrate. Police duty has also been imposed in the electrical sub-centre. Due to the strict action of the District Magistrate, there has been a stir among the employees of the Electricity Department.

At the same time, DM Manoj Kumar said that the electrical contract workers on whom action has been taken were outsourced employees. These people had participated in the strike against the rules, whose services have been terminated, now they will not be able to work in the electricity department anywhere in the state.
